Beef pinwheels filled with vegetables and cheese are a different approach to regular steak. Full of flavour, easy to make and served on a stick, they are a fun addition to a garden BBQ.
Supplies
- 400-600 g beef- large piece of flank steak works best, but pre-cut slices would work too
- Homemade or store-bought Boursin cheese
- 2 cups fresh spinach
- 2-4 roasted red peppers
- Salt, pepper, spices and herbs to taste
- Thick bamboo skewers

Slice peppers into long strips and remove stems from spinach leaves.
Place beef between layers of cling film and pound with a wooden mallet or rolling pin to tenderise and thin out the meat.
Season the meat with salt and pepper and any spices or herbs of your choosing.
Filling

Spread a layer of cheese all over the meat, add spinach and press leaves into the cheese. Add peppers, either in strips and sparsely, or halved peppers all over the meat.
Rolling

Use cling film to aid you in rolling the meat. Make it as tight as possible. Cover in cling film and refrigerate for a few hours.
Cutting

Poke skewers in the meat every 1 - 1 1/2 inch apart and slice the meat between skewers.
Cooking

They can be grilled, cooked in the oven, broiled or fried. Grill each side for 2-4 minutes, depending on how done you want the meat to be.
